Additional Property Attributes

Per Phase I ESA, no RECs, HRECs, or CRECs were identified. However, Business Environmental Risks were. Historical uses of the property included the Norfolk & Ocean View railroad, an automotive repair facility, waste paper storage facility, junkyard, and lumberyard. Additionally, two adjacent off-site facilities were identified on the UST/LUST database. The potential for subsurface contamination exists.

Former Use: The subject Site is comprised of one parcel encompassing 4.55 acres of vacant, grass-covered land. According to historical records, the subject Site was formerly developed, occupied by residences and later commercial entities. Past uses of environmental concern include the Norfolk & Ocean View railroad, automotive facility, waste paper facility, lumberyard, and junk yard. By 1970, the subject Site included the Holiday Inn Motel which continued operations until sometime in 2002. By 2003, the subject Site was vacant and has remained as such since.
